Xiaoqing Song is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ry and Plant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Xiaoqing Song has authored 53 papers receiving a total of 688 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 40 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 4 papers in Materials Chemistry and 4 papers in Plant Science. Recurrent topics in Xiaoqing Song’s work include Silicon Carbide Semiconductor Technologies (32 papers), HVDC Systems and Fault Protection (21 papers) and Multilevel Inverters and Converters (11 papers). Xiaoqing Song is often cited by papers focused on Silicon Carbide Semiconductor Technologies (32 papers), HVDC Systems and Fault Protection (21 papers) and Multilevel Inverters and Converters (11 papers). Xiaoqing Song collaborates with scholars based in United States, China and Italy. Xiaoqing Song's co-authors include Alex Q. Huang, Chang Peng, Iqbal Husain, Xijun Ni, Liqi Zhang, Pietro Cairoli, Yu Du, Pengkun Liu, Pengkun Liu and Antonello Antoniazzi and has published in prestigious journals such as Food Chemistry, IEEE Transactions on Power Electronics and Geoderma.
